Article Title: Synaptic ERK2 Phosphorylates and Regulates Metabotropic Glutamate Receptor 1 In Vitro and in Neurons
doi: 10.1007/s12035-016-0225-4
Figure Lengend Snippet: Phosphorylation of mGluR1a-CT2 by ERK2. a Amino acid sequence analysis of mGluR1a-CT2(P1001-L1199). Eight ERK2 phosphorylation motifs (T/SP) are highlighted in red. Potential phosphorylation sites include T1064 (1), S1098 (2), T1143 (3), S1147 (4), T1151 (5), S1154 (6), S1169 (7), and T1178 (8). b A representative phosphoamino acid analysis showing GST-mGluR1a-CT2 phosphorylation at serine (pSer), but not threonine (pThr) and tyrosine (pTyr), residues. c, d Phosphorylation of mGluR1a-CT2 at pS/TP (c) and pTP (d) motifs by active ERK2. e Five mutants (M1–5) derived from mGluR1a-CT2(P1001-L1199). Site-directed mutants include mutations of T1064/S1098 to alanines (M1), T1064/S1098/T1143/S1147 to alanines (M2), T1064/S1098/T1143/S1147/T1151/S1154 to alanines (M3), four serines (S1098/S1147/S1154/S1169) to alanines (M4), and four threonines (T1064/T1143/T1151/T1178) to alanines (M5). e Phosphorylation of mGluR1a-CT2 mutants and WT at pS/TP by active ERK2. Note that no signal was detected in the M4 mutant. g Phosphorylation of GST-mGluR1a-CT2 and Elk-1 at PXpSP by active ERK2. Phosphorylation of CT2 and Elk-1 was detected by immunoblot (IB) with a phosphomotif antibody against pS/TP (c, f), pTP (d), or PXpSP (g)
Article Snippet: GST or GST-fusion proteins were incubated with GST-tagged active ERK2 (Millipore, 25 ng) or GST- or His-tagged inactive ERK2 (Millipore, 25 ng) for 30 min at 30 °C in a reaction buffer (25 μl) containing 10 mM HEPES pH 7.4, 10 mM MgCl 2 , 1 mM Na 3 VO 4 , 1 mM dithiothreitol (DTT), 0.1 mg/ml BSA, 50 μM ATP, and 2.5 μCi/tube [γ- 32 P]ATP (~3000 Ci/mmol, PerkinElmer, Waltham, MA) with an Elk-1 fusion protein (Cell Signaling, Danvers, MA).
